Aizawl, Oct 31: Union Minister for Earth Science Kiren Rijiju on Tuesday said that the BJP-led NDA government will never scrap article 371 of the Constitution as it had scrapped article 370 of the Constitution pertaining to Jammu and Kashmir.

Speaking to media persons in Aizawl, Rijiju said that the BJP had promised to remove the article in its manifesto. “Union Home Minister Amit Shah clearly said on the floor of the Parliament that Article 370 of the Constitution created a barrier between the people of Kashmir and the rest of the country. So article 370 was removed for better integrity of the nation” he said.

Anyone who says that the BJP, if voted to power will scrap Article 371 and its provisions does not know the ground reality, he said.

Rijiju said that Shah also said in the Parliament that provisions of Article 371, for Nagaland, Mizoram, Arunachal, Meghalaya and others are to be protected, rather than removed.

“Article 371 is for protecting our tribal customs, practices, traditions, our dialects, our identities, which has to be protected, if necessary to be strengthened,” he said, adding, that those who are saying that article 371 is in danger have been saying it for many years.

The people who are saying this kind of bogus issue are insulting the people of the northeast region, Rijiju said.

He said that BJP is the only party that could ensure the security and prosperity of the people of Mizoram and North East and that the saffron party if voted to power in the state, will fulfil all the promises that have been reflected in the ‘Vision Document’.

“Mizoram will become one of the most prosperous states under BJP,” the Union Minister said, adding that the second airport will be constructed in the state.

On the issue of Israel and Hamas conflict, he said that the Indian government condemned all forms of terrorism and Prime Minister Narendra Modi condemned terrorist attacks on Israel by the Hamas on October 7. “We are not talking about politics or political rights of Palestine or political rights of Israel. But we are against any acts of terrorism,” he said.

He accused the Congress party of supporting the Hamas attacks on Israel, saying, “They (the Congress) could not condemn the Hamas for the terrorist attacks against Israel. Neither Rahul Gandhi nor Priyanka Gandhi Vadra have condemned the Hamas,” he added.
